South Korea has secured an export quarantine agreement with Ecuador, enabling the country to export pears to the South American nation. The agreement, which took 10 years to negotiate, broadens the export market for pears, one of the top 10 fresh agricultural products with an annual export volume of approximately 20,000 tons. To export to Ecuador, Korean pears must adhere to specific quarantine requirements. The Agriculture, Forestry and Livestock Quarantine Headquarters intends to formulate export guidelines for Korean pears to facilitate the export process.
